Bill Text: IL SR1067 | 2009-2010 | 96th General Assembly | Introduced
Bill Title: Mourns the death of Gregg John Davis of Naperville.
Sponsorship: Partisan Bill (Republican 1)
Status: (Passed) 2010-12-02 - Resolution Adopted [SR1067 Detail]

| 1 | SENATE RESOLUTION
| ||||||
| 2 | WHEREAS, The members of the Illinois Senate are saddened to | ||||||
| 3 | learn of the death of Gregg John Davis of Naperville, who | ||||||
| 4 | passed away on August 8, 2010; and
| ||||||
| 5 | WHEREAS, He was born to Ruth and John Davis in October of | ||||||
| 6 | 1937, in Scotia, Nebraska; he grew up in Strawberry Point, | ||||||
| 7 | Iowa, and attended the University of Iowa, Iowa City, where he | ||||||
| 8 | met his wife of 50 years, Nancy (nee Humbert); they were | ||||||
| 9 | married in July of 1960; and
| ||||||
| 10 | WHEREAS, He began his 43 year career in the property | ||||||
| 11 | casualty insurance business at a small mutual insurance company | ||||||
| 12 | in Cedar Rapids, Iowa as a claims adjuster; he progressed | ||||||
| 13 | through a number of claim management positions with several | ||||||
| 14 | companies before becoming employed by the Illinois Department | ||||||
| 15 | of Insurance as a claim auditor in 1972, progressing to the | ||||||
| 16 | position of Assistant Deputy Director; he moved to Naperville | ||||||
| 17 | in 1984 to join Virginia Surety Insurance Company until his | ||||||
| 18 | retirement in 2002 as an executive vice-president; and
| ||||||
| 19 | WHEREAS, He was known by all as a kind, gentle, and | ||||||
| 20 | generous man of integrity, always ready with some | ||||||
| 21 | encouragement, a word of wisdom or just a listening ear; in his | ||||||
| 22 | later years he developed an interest in good wine and a passion | ||||||
| |||||||
| |||||||
| 1 | for gourmet cooking to the delight of his family and friends; | ||||||
| 2 | and
| ||||||
| 3 | WHEREAS, After his retirement he became a volunteer at the | ||||||
| 4 | Calvary Church Food Pantry/Clothes Closet ministry in downtown | ||||||
| 5 | Naperville; and
| ||||||
| 6 | WHEREAS, Gregg Davis is survived by his wife, Nancy; their | ||||||
| 7 | three daughters, Chrystal Gray, Sheryl (Michael) Stille, and | ||||||
| 8 | Rachel Bobak; his 6 grandchildren and 2 great-grandchildren; | ||||||
| 9 | his mother, Ruth Davis; his sisters, Sonya (the late Robert) | ||||||
| 10 | Davis and Anita (Robert Fontenelle) McDonald; and a large | ||||||
| 11 | gentle dog named Monet; therefore, be it
| ||||||
| 12 | RESOLVED, BY THE SENATE OF THE NINETY-SIXTH GENERAL | ||||||
| 13 | 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F ILLINOIS, that we mourn, along with | ||||||
| 14 | his family and friends, the passing of Gregg John Davis; and be | ||||||
| 15 | it further
| ||||||
| 16 | RESOLVED, That a suitable copy of this resolution be | ||||||
| 17 | presented to the family of Gregg John Davis as a symbol of our | ||||||
| 18 | sincere sympathy.
